Install Engineer, Internet Services

Encore is a service provider organization delivering network services to clients and hoteliers in the hospitality industry. The Install Engineer will be responsible for the design, installation, and support of WAN/LAN, wireless, voice, and video network solutions, acting as a consultant to both external clients and internal employees.

Responsibilities

Coordinate IS project responsibilities including project organization, technical design, logistics communication, and execution with Partners, Contractors, and Project Manager
Follow and maintain design and wireless best practices and methodologies for survey, installation, and event usage. Regularly review documentation and stay current on new and changing guidelines
Conduct onsite and remote technical projects such as
Network infrastructure surveys and mandatory deliverable documentation
Network and/or upgrade designs per Encore and brand/industry standards or custom requests
Network infrastructure installations and mandatory operational documentation
Event engineering and support as required
Provide technical training for internal and external users on network, systems, and applications capabilities as required
Act as technical design lead and level three support for internal network engineers and event managers assisting with field employees, clients, and guest room support teams
Consult with internal and external end users on event and network requirements including pre-sales discovery and support
Develop and implement network best-practices management and maintenance procedures for our clients. Attend client discovery meetings, demo and present solutions, and provide necessary input into RFI’s and RFP’s
Prepare proposals for hardware, software, and professional services as required. Develop, present, and demonstrate solutions to prospective customers based on detailed customer requirements to highlight broad solution areas with emphasis on key differentiators to both technical and non-technical audiences
Responsible for monitoring and analyzing network performance and device behavior and adhere to departmental standards and service level agreements (SLA)
Proactively identify and lead remediation efforts of potential network issues
Follow incident response management procedures, acknowledgement and supervision of alerts, and provide reports and escalation information to stakeholders. Perform and review routine network preventative health checks and maintenance
Interface as third tier level of support for Network Operations Center for all routers, switches, access points, wireless controllers, VoIP services, and network management systems in WAN and LAN
Responsible for staying current with approved network hardware and software manufactures, such as; Cisco/Meraki, Ruckus, HP/Aruba, Solarwinds, Apple, Microsoft, etc
Prepare and deliver training, guides, and formal documentation to internal and external employees and customers on specific hardware, software, and services as directed
Organize and lead efforts to utilize in-house lab environment for testing new functionality, features, and software upgrades as well as simulating current issues and behaviors of client setups

Required

Bachelor of Computer Science or equivalent job experience
At least 3 years of experience within the last 10 years working in a multi-network, multi-protocol Enterprise environment
3+ years of Cisco IOS and hardware experience. Familiarity with the following Cisco hardware: 2800, 2900, 3900, 4451x, ASR 1001, or better series routers; 2950, 2960/S/X, 3560/X, 3750/X, 4500, or better catalyst switches; 2500, 4400, 5800, 5520, or better Wireless LAN Controllers; 1130-3500, 1600-3600, 1700-3700, 1800-4800 or better autonomous and LWAP/CWAP series access points
3 + years of experience implementing Wireless (WiFi) 802.11a/b/g/n technologies with vendors such as Cisco/Meraki, Ruckus, HP/Aruba, and Extreme Networks
Demonstrated proficiency and experience in one or more of the following areas: Routing and Switching, Security, Wireless, Video/Voice
Strong verbal and written communication skills, including the ability to influence other levels of management, develop technical documentation, and create customer / internal communications
Ability to analyze network performance data to identify trends and potential problems, and support recommendations to modify and/or upgrade network equipment or services
Excellent interpersonal skills with a focus on listening and questioning
Ability to participate as an on-call for level 3 escalation, requiring availability 24 hours a day, 7 days a week
Ability to demonstrate Encore's core promises to its internal and external customers; Hospitality, Responsiveness, Ownership and Professionalism

Preferred

Preferred Certifications: Cisco CCNA/CCDA/CCNP with Wireless specialties, and other equivalent network and wireless vendors
Experience with Cisco ACS, Prime/WCS, Solarwinds products, or other network monitoring tools preferred
